AI Summary
- Amends Minnesota Statutes 2008, section 144A.13, subdivision 2, regarding nursing home residents' rights
- Requires nursing home administrators to inform residents in writing at admission of the right to complain about facility accommodations and services
- Requires posting of complaint rights notice in the nursing home and informing residents of the right to complain to the commissioner of health
- Prohibits nursing home employees or controlling persons from retaliating against residents who file complaints
- Specifies that residents cannot be denied rights available under sections 504B.205, 504B.206, and 504B.211
